The graduate school at the Medical University of South Carolina (MUSC) offers a wide range of programs and opportunities for students seeking advanced degrees in various medical, health, and biomedical fields. With a strong emphasis on research and interdisciplinary collaboration, MUSC's graduate programs provide students with the necessary skills and knowledge to excel in their chosen fields and contribute to cutting-edge scientific advancements. The graduate school at MUSC also boasts a diverse and inclusive community, offering a supportive and engaging environment for students from different backgrounds.
One of the key strengths of the graduate school at MUSC is its extensive range of programs. Students can choose from over 50 different graduate programs, including doctoral, master's, and certificate options. These programs span a wide range of disciplines, such as biomedical sciences, clinical research, healthcare administration, nursing, neuroscience, pharmacy, and public health, among others. This breadth ensures that students can pursue their specific areas of interest and tailor their education to their career goals.
At MUSC, research is a core component of graduate education. The university has a strong focus on translational research, aiming to bridge the gap between scientific discoveries and clinical applications. MUSC's graduate students have access to state-of-the-art facilities, cutting-edge technologies, and renowned faculty who are actively involved in pioneering research. The university prioritizes interdisciplinary collaboration, encouraging students to work across departments and schools to address complex healthcare challenges. This interdisciplinary approach fosters innovation and equips graduates with the skills necessary to make meaningful contributions to the healthcare industry.

Located in Charleston, SC and set in an urban environment, Medical University of South Carolina is a public upper-level higher education institution with graduate programs. This school follows a semester-based calendar. Learn more about what Medical University of South Carolina has to offer based on the most recent data this institution has reported.

The school has an overall of 2,461 students, according to the data from 2024.
Student Population Gender Ratio
According to the most recent information, this school has 985 male and 1,476 female students. The fact that there are more female than male students speaks volumes about the significance gendar equality has at this institution.

Tuition and Fees
Wondering about tuition at Medical University of South Carolina? Here is what you need to know.
According to the reports from public county and municipal institutions, tuition fees were $16,333 for area residents. For students who don't live in the state in which the university is located, the tuition was $24,304 in 2024. For the students coming from abroad, tuition at this school was $24,304, as well. Fees per academic year required of full-time students totaled $1,369 in 2024.
| Tuition | Fees | Total | |
|---|---|---|---|
| Out-of-State | $24,304 | $1,369 | $25,673 |
| In-State | $16,333 | $1,369 | $17,702 |

Faculty
1.9:1
Student to Faculty Ratio
The student-to-faculty ratio can tell you a lot about the teaching resources a school provides for its students.
According to the latest information, the total number of faculty members at this school is 1,291. There were 762 male and 529 female teachers at this school in 2024.
